Aider

Công cụ AI để chỉnh sửa mã trong repos git cục bộ thông qua thiết bị đầu cuối.
Aider thông tin sản phẩm
Đã bao giờ nghe nói về Aider? Nó không chỉ là một công cụ AI khác; Nó giống như có một người bạn mã hóa ngay trong thiết bị đầu cuối của bạn. AIDER là một công cụ lập trình cặp AI đi vào kho Git cục bộ của bạn, cho phép bạn điều chỉnh và chỉnh sửa mã một cách dễ dàng. Nó cũng khá linh hoạt, làm việc với một loạt các mô hình ngôn ngữ khác nhau (LLM) và hỗ trợ một loạt các ngôn ngữ lập trình. Cho dù bạn đang thích Python, JavaScript hay thứ gì đó thích hợp hơn, Aider đã khiến bạn được bảo hiểm.
Làm thế nào để bắt đầu với Aider?
Bắt đầu với Aider là một làn gió. Đầu tiên, bạn sẽ muốn cài đặt nó bằng PIP. Sau khi hoàn thành, chỉ cần điều hướng đến thư mục dự án của bạn và kích hoạt Aider. Hãy chắc chắn rằng bạn đã sẵn sàng mô hình và khóa API ưa thích của mình và tất cả bạn đều được thiết lập để bắt đầu chỉnh sửa mã như một pro.
Điều gì làm cho Aider nổi bật?
Aider không chỉ là một công cụ khác trong nhà kho; Nó được đóng gói với các tính năng làm cho mã hóa trở thành niềm vui. Đây là những gì bạn có thể mong đợi:
Lập trình cặp AI
Hãy tưởng tượng có một đối tác mã hóa luôn luôn đúng. Tính năng lập trình cặp AI của Aider giống như có một đôi mắt thứ hai, giúp bạn bắt lỗi và đề xuất các cải tiến khi bạn đi.
Tích hợp Git
Không còn dò dẫm xung quanh với các lệnh git. AIDER tích hợp liền mạch với Git, làm cho phiên bản điều khiển một cách nhanh chóng.
Nhiều hỗ trợ LLM
Cho dù bạn là người hâm mộ của GPT-3, Codex hay LLM khác, AIDER hỗ trợ tất cả. Bạn có thể chuyển đổi giữa các mô hình để tìm một mô hình phù hợp nhất với dự án của bạn.
Chỉnh sửa mã thời gian thực
Với AIDER, bạn có thể chỉnh sửa mã trong thời gian thực. Nó giống như xem mã của bạn trở nên sống động khi bạn gõ, với phản hồi và đề xuất tức thì.
Tự động git cam kết
Quên về những thay đổi cam kết thủ công. Aider làm điều đó cho bạn, giữ cho kho lưu trữ của bạn được cập nhật mà không cần thêm bất kỳ nỗ lực nào từ phía bạn.
Bạn có thể làm gì với Aider?
Tính linh hoạt của Aider tỏa sáng trong các trường hợp sử dụng của nó. Dưới đây là một vài ví dụ:
Tạo một ứng dụng bình đơn giản
Bạn muốn xây dựng một ứng dụng Flask? Aider có thể hướng dẫn bạn trong suốt quá trình, từ việc thiết lập môi trường đến viết mã.
Sửa đổi một trò chơi 2048 nguồn mở
Có một ý tưởng để cải thiện trò chơi 2048 cổ điển? AIDER có thể giúp bạn sửa đổi mã và thực hiện các thay đổi của bạn một cách trơn tru.
Hoàn thành bài tập CSS
Đấu tranh với CSS? Aider có thể hỗ trợ bạn hoàn thành các bài tập, giúp bạn làm chủ nghệ thuật phong cách.
Câu hỏi thường gặp về Aider
- Người hỗ trợ Aider hỗ trợ ngôn ngữ nào?
- AIDER hỗ trợ một loạt các ngôn ngữ lập trình, từ Python và JavaScript đến các ngôn ngữ chuyên biệt hơn.
- Tôi có thể sử dụng Aider với các mô hình địa phương không?
- Có, Aider có thể làm việc với các mô hình địa phương, mang lại cho bạn sự linh hoạt trong môi trường phát triển của bạn.
- Là nguồn mở Aider?
- Aider thực sự là nguồn mở, cho phép cộng đồng đóng góp và cải thiện công cụ.
Tìm thêm về Aider?
Nếu bạn đang tìm cách lặn sâu hơn vào người phụ trách, đây là một số tài nguyên:
Aider trên Reddit
Tham gia cuộc trò chuyện trên Reddit tại trang Reddit của Aider .
Công ty Aider
Aider được Aider AI, một công ty chuyên nâng cao để nâng cao trải nghiệm mã hóa của bạn.
Aider trên YouTube
Kiểm tra Aider trong hành động trên YouTube tại liên kết này .
Aider trên GitHub
Khám phá mã nguồn và đóng góp cho AIDER trên GitHub tại trang GitHub của Aider .
Aider ảnh chụp màn hình
Aider đánh giá
Bạn có muốn giới thiệu Aider không? Đăng bình luận của bạn
